Arthropod Assemblages in Invasive and Native Vegetation of Great Salt Lake Wetlands

Emily E. Leonard et al.

Summary: This study examined the differences in arthropod assemblages between native and invasive vegetation in the Great Salt Lake wetlands, finding minimal differences between Phragmites and two native habitats, while significant differences were observed with the native pickleweed. Understanding the interactions between arthropods and different vegetation types is crucial for effective wetland management for bird habitat.
